Clinical summary
Summary
Eligible participants will receive HRS-6209 capsules and fulvestrant hormone therapy as an injection. HRS-6209 will be taken twice a day, and fulvestrant will be given once.
Conditions
This trial is treating people with HR+ or HER2- solid tumours
Eligibility
Inclusion
- Ability to understand the trial procedures and possible adverse events, voluntarily participate in the trial.
- Adequate bone marrow and other vital organ functions
- Adequate liver function tests
- HR-positive or HER2-negative solid tumor patients
Exclusion
- Plan to receive any other anti-tumor therapy during the study.
- Active brain metastases .
- Have poorly controlled or severe cardiovascular disease, including (1) congestive heart failure.
- Previous use of fulvestrant
- clinically significant endometrial abnormalities, including but not limited to endometrial hyperplasia and dysfunctional uterine bleeding.
- With uncontrollable chronic systemic complications (such as severe chronic lung, liver, kidney, or heart disease).
- With acute or active tuberculosis infection requiring medication.
- Pregnant or lactating women, or females planning to become pregnant During the study.
- Known history of clinically significant liver disease, untreated active hepatitis (hepatitis B, defined as hepatitis B virus surface antigen [HBsAg] or hepatitis B core antibody [HBcAb] positive

Scientific Title
An Open-Label, Multi-Center Phase II Clinical Study Evaluating the Safety, Tolerability, Pharmacokinetics, and Preliminary Efficacy of HRS-6209 in Combination With Fulvestrant or Letrozole in Patients With Solid Tumor
